The electron cloud around the oxygen nuclei in the O2 WebIn ice, oxygen atoms also occupy the centers of 4 out of the 8 smaller cubes. The lines that connect each internal oxygen atom to a vertex oxygen and 3 oxygens on the faces of the big cube are actually bridging hydrogen atoms: O-H-O units. Each oxygen atom is in a tetrahedron of hydrogen atoms. top 10 niches 2022

WebA molecule is composed of two or more atoms by chemical bond (s). An oxygen atom has an atomic radius of 60 picometers. 1 picometer is 10^-12 meters. Thus, the atomic radius of oxygen is 6.0 x 10^-11 meters, making the diameter twice this or 1.2 x 10^-10 meters. Have taught Mol Bio and Biochem for 43 years.

WebNov 21, 2024 · The atomic radius of Oxygen atom is 66pm (covalent radius). It must be noted, atoms lack a well-defined outer boundary. The atomic radius of a chemical element is a measure of the distance out to which the electron cloud extends from the nucleus. WebAn atom of oxygen has a diameter of 7.4 x 10 –11 m.
